Transaction 2afbc638ef93258237ee9b5c0410fd2850ba39fd07aa000886334c3da92e492e
1 Input
1 Output
-
2afbc638ef93258237ee9b5c0410fd2850ba39fd07aa000886334c3da92e492e:0
- value
- 89125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f94a22e123ab43ae00e80157b1f3e432f6ec6419 OP_EQUAL
- address
- 3QR8zPMsypXvsRBbgGwH5CfKrK6zopUNVh